- The distance between Rochester/ Rochester-Monroe, Ny, Usa and Winnibigoshish Dam, Mn, Usa is approximately 1,351 km or 839 mi.
- To reach Rochester/ Rochester-Monroe, Ny in this distance one would set out from Winnibigoshish Dam, Mn bearing 102.7°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Rochester/ Rochester-Monroe, Ny bearing 114.3° or ESE .
- Both have a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 4.3 °C (7.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.4 °C (16.9°F) less in Rochester/ Rochester-Monroe, Ny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 134.6 mm (5.3 in) more which is equivalent to 134.6 l/m² (3.3 US gal/ft²) or 1,346,000 l/ha (143,896 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.9° higher in Rochester/ Rochester-Monroe, Ny than in Winnibigoshish Dam, Mn.
